Answer:

Joel's coin collection had 120 dimes and 80 quarters.

Step-by-step explanation:

Given that Joel had a coin collection of two hundred coins, which were dimes and quarters, and the total value was worth $32, to determine how many coins of each type he had, the following equations must be performed:

0.25 - 0.10 = 0.15

200 x 0.10 = 20

32 - 20 = 12

12 / 0.15 = 80

200 - 80 = 120

(80 x 0.25) + (120 x 0.1) = X

20 + 12 = X

32 = X

Therefore, Joel's coin collection had 120 dimes and 80 quarters.

Change 0.7 to a common fraction
erma4kov [3.2K]

Answer:

7/10

Step-by-step explanation:

In 0.7 we will change the decimal to fraction. First we will write the decimal without the decimal point as the numerator. Now in the denominator, write 1 followed by one zeros as there are 1 digit in the decimal part of the decimal number. Therefore, we observe that 0.7 (decimal) is converted to 7/10 (fraction).
